Historical Highlights of the Junior League of Albuquerque

1961-1970
Projects included:
Fundraising for Albuquerque Vocational Clinic
Assisted New Mexico Arts and Crafts Fair
Established docent program at UNM Art Museum
Established Albuquerque Tutoring Council
Established Information/Referral Service
Established The Volunteer Bureau (part of Information and Referral Service)
Established the Arts Council Project
Collaborated with APD and APS on 3-Year Model Cities Child Safety Project
Funds provided to:
Major grant to All Faiths Receiving Home
Family Consultation Services
Albuquerque Public Library
Drug Abuse Education Center
Received recognition from:
Albuquerque City Commission – JLA awarded Distinguished Service and Merit Award
